How to Start a Car Repair Business

Starting a car repair business can be a rewarding venture for automotive enthusiasts with mechanical skills and business acumen.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to start a car repair business:

  1. Research the Market: Conduct market research to assess the demand for car repair services in your area. Identify your target market, competitors, and potential customers. Consider factors such as location, demographics, and local competition when evaluating market opportunities.
  2. Write a Business Plan: Develop a comprehensive business plan outlining your business goals, target market, services offered, pricing strategy, marketing plan, and financial projections. A well-written business plan serves as a roadmap for your business and helps attract investors or secure financing.
  3. Choose a Business Structure: Decide on the legal structure for your car repair business, such as a sole proprietorship, partnership, limited liability company (LLC), or corporation. Choose a structure that suits your business needs and offers liability protection for you and your assets.
  4. Obtain Necessary Licenses and Permits: Research the regulatory requirements for operating a car repair business in your area. Obtain any required business licenses, permits, zoning approvals, and environmental permits from local and state authorities. Compliance with environmental regulations is especially important when handling automotive fluids and hazardous materials.
  5. Secure a Suitable Location: Find a suitable location for your car repair shop, ideally in a high-traffic area with good visibility and accessibility. Consider factors such as proximity to major roads, parking availability, and space requirements for equipment and inventory.
  6. Equip Your Workshop: Equip your car repair shop with the necessary tools, equipment, and machinery to perform automotive repairs and maintenance. Invest in high-quality tools and diagnostic equipment to ensure efficient and accurate service. Consider purchasing used equipment to save on costs, if possible.
  7. Hire Skilled Technicians: Hire skilled and experienced technicians to perform automotive repairs and maintenance in your shop. Look for technicians with relevant certifications, training, and experience in the automotive industry. Provide ongoing training and development opportunities to keep your staff updated on the latest automotive technologies and repair techniques.
  8. Offer a Range of Services: Offer a comprehensive range of automotive repair and maintenance services to meet the needs of your customers. This may include services such as oil changes, brake repairs, engine diagnostics, suspension repairs, and electrical system repairs. Consider specializing in certain types of repairs or servicing specific makes and models to differentiate your business from competitors.
  9. Market Your Business: Promote your car repair business to attract customers and generate sales. Utilize a variety of marketing channels, including online advertising, social media marketing, search engine optimization (SEO), local advertising, and networking within the automotive industry. Offer promotions, discounts, and loyalty programs to incentivize repeat business and referrals.
  10. Provide Excellent Customer Service: Focus on delivering exceptional customer service to build trust and loyalty with your customers. Offer transparent pricing, timely service, and clear communication throughout the repair process. Encourage customer feedback and address any concerns or complaints promptly to ensure customer satisfaction.
  11. Maintain Financial Records: Keep accurate financial records of your car repair business, including income, expenses, invoices, and receipts. Implement a reliable accounting system or software to track your finances and monitor your business performance. Regularly review your financial reports and adjust your business strategy as needed to achieve your financial goals.
  12. Stay Informed and Adapt: Stay informed about changes in the automotive industry, including advancements in technology, regulatory requirements, and consumer trends. Continuously monitor your business performance, customer feedback, and market trends to identify areas for improvement and adaptation.

By following these steps and investing time and effort into building a reputable and customer-focused car repair business, you can establish a successful and profitable venture in the automotive industry.
